| dc.description.abstract | A reflective type polarizer-free, color-filter-free and bistable displays using a liquid crystal and polymer composite film (LCPCF) is demonstrated. The main mechanism is based on the droplet manipulation on LCPCF whose wettability is electrically tunable. The surface properties of LCPCF are discussed. The potential applications of LCPCF are electronic papers and biosensors. | en_US |
